4-coumaroyl-D-glucose hydroxylase

from sweet potato roots (Ipomoea batatas); catalyzes the conversion of p-coumaroyl-D-glucose to caffeoyl-D-glucose for chlorogenic acid biosynthesis in the presence of ascorbic acid; MW 33 kDa; has weak polyphenol oxidase activity; also hydroxylates p-coumaric acid
Also Known As:
CDG hydroxylase; p-coumaroyl-D-glucose hydroxylase
